App State’s Houston and James Madison’s Humphrey Claim Sun Belt Softball Weekly Honors

NEW ORLEANS – App State’s Kayt Houston and James Madison’s Alissa Humphrey claimed Sun Belt softball weekly honors after propelling their teams to successful weekends. 
 
Player of the Week
Kayt Houston, App State
[SR | OF | Rock Hill, S.C.]
 
Kayt Houston had a historic weekend at the Winthrop Eagle Classic, tallying 12 hits, four home runs and 11 RBI throughout the five-game set in her hometown. On Friday, Houston led off the first game of the weekend with a home run before blasting a three-run homer in the fifth inning for a multi-homer game. In game two, Houston scorched two more homers and four more RBI to cap off a six hit, four homer, nine RBI day on Friday. Houston stayed hot on day two against both Winthrop and Binghamton, cracking four more hits in six at-bats, including her third double of the weekend. Finally, Houston wrapped up her incredible five-game stretch with two more doubles and two more RBI against Mount St. Mary's in a 15-0 win. Houston was the catalyst on offense in App State's 4-1 weekend as she hit to a .667/.700/1.556 slash line in the five games. She reached base 14 times while also scoring eight runs. 
 
Pitcher of the Week
Alissa Humphrey, James Madison
[SR | P | Micanopy, Fla.]

In James Madison’s 4-0 weekend, Alissa Humphrey made two appearances, allowing zero runs in 12 innings of work, walking one batter and striking out 14. The senior pitcher only allowed seven hits in those 12 innings, and allowed opponents to hit only .167. Humphrey threw a complete game in the 7-0 win over George Mason, striking out eight batters and only allowing five hits. In her first appearance of the weekend, the Micanopy, Fla., native, threw five scoreless innings of relief vs. Lehigh, allowing only two hits and striking out six.
